USA Pro Challenge official commemorative poster contest

The 2014 USA Pro Challenge will again host a nationwide US contest inviting artists to create a national event poster for the fourth annual race that will be seen throughout the world. All types of artists – professional, amateur, aspiring – are encouraged to let their creativity flow and submit their designs via the USA Pro Challenge Facebook page beginning on Friday 21 March.

Entries will be accepted until Friday 18 April; fans can then vote on their favourite poster through to 2 May, with the winners being announced on Monday 5 May.

Artists will have plenty to draw upon as the 2014 Pro Challenge route guides the world’s elite cyclists through some of the most beautiful settings in the country.

“We’re looking for something that captures the picturesque scenery of Colorado, in addition to the spirit of the intense competition of the USA Pro Challenge,” said Shawn Hunter, CEO of the USA Pro Challenge.

“We have seen some incredible artwork submissions through the poster contest in previous years and we expect the creativity level to be sky-high this year. This tradition gives fans another opportunity to become a part of the largest professional cycling race in the US.”

Once entries are submitted, the race’s thousands of loyal Facebook fans will have a chance to cast their votes for the ten best national posters. From there, the USA Pro Challenge team will select the winner. The winner will receive four passes to the VIP hospitality tent in the city of their choice, in addition to having his/her poster produced and sold to fans both online and onsite during the race on 18-24 August.

All entries must be submitted via the USA Pro Challenge Facebook contest page (only online entries will be eligible). This requires either that the artwork be in digital media format or that a digital photograph of the artwork be posted in accordance with the rules, terms and conditions adopted by Facebook.

Each file must be in JPEG format and otherwise comply with Facebook’s requirements for posting. Multiple entries may be submitted, but must be submitted at the same time.

This is a skill-based contest and chance plays no part in the determination of winners. There is no fee to enter and no purchase is required. Official rules for the program can be found at www.facebook.com/USAProCyclingChallenge.

Referred to as ‘America’s Race’, the USA Pro Challenge will take place on 18-24 August 2014. For seven consecutive days, the world’s top athletes race through the majestic Colorado Rockies, ‘reaching higher altitudes than they’ve ever had to endure.’ One of the largest cycling events in US history and the largest spectator event in the history of the state of Colorado, the USA Pro Challenge features a challenging course, will spotlight the best of the best in professional cycling and some of America’s most beautiful scenery.
